SevenSixTwo wrote:Tip:

Don't fanny around with handwarmers in your hand. Get two loose-fitting towling wristbands ('sweatbands') and make an opening in them to fully accommodate the warmer. Apply to your wrists and the heat will encourage bloodflow to your hands/arms a lot better. As a consequence, heat will return to your core with greater efficiency too.
